This antiquarian book contains Elbert Hubbard's 1912 biography of Andrew Taylor Still, "Andrew Taylor Still - Being a Little Journey to the Home of the Founder of Osteopathy". This short but detailed biography is based on the author's personal experience and acquaintance with Mr Still, and furnishes an authentic and insightful look into his life, mind, and career.
